Wine 10.0 Expected This Week For Improving Windows Software On Linux

After six release candidates going back to early December, it looks like Wine 10.0 stable will be ready to ship this week. This is largely as expected with the annual Wine stable releases tending to come around mid-to-late January. Wine 10.0 in turn should serve as the basis for Valve's Steam Play (Proton 10.0) as well as updated versions of CodeWeavers CrossOver and other software.
